Co-operation Journal Writing Rules


Arbitrators’ advice is taken before an article is published on the Journal. In order to publish such articles delivered to the Publication Board, the Board must find it acceptable with respect to these Writing Rules and the Arbitrators Committee must approve it. If such articles are not approved for publication, the relevant author(s) are informed accordingly

Articles on co-operation, agricultural management, economics, management, socio-cultural etc. in the world and Turkey are to be involved in the Üçüncü Sektör Kooperatifçilik (Third Sector Co-operative) Journal.

Articles must have a clear expression and be written with a 1.5 line spacing on a maximum of 15 standard pages, with one sides filled only. The technical and foreign terms, with no equivalent in Turkish, must be shortly clarified within parentheses.

In case of translated articles, the name, volume, issue, page number(s), author, and the relevant country of the source article are to be quoted. The original article copy must be appended, when appropriate.

Articles published on this Journal bear only the opinions of their authors. They are not binding on the Association.

Figures, graphs, and tables are to be numbered, and are to be quoted under the references, if they have any titles  

The name and title of author must be stated under the title of article, and if such author has an attached institution, its name must be stated under the first page

Sources utilized within scientific articles must be numbered within the text as (1), (2), etc. and be quoted at the end of text according to the sequence as referred to therein.
        if the source is an article; surname and name of author, full title of article, name of publisher, volume number, issue, year, and page number(s) are to be indicated;
        if the source is a book; surname and name of author, name of book, name of editor (if present), name of publisher, publication place, publication number, year, and page number(s) are to be indicated; and
        if the source is a paper; name and surname of author, title of paper, title of congress, seminar, or conference, place of organization, year, page number(s) are to be indicated;


The articles must have an English title and an English and Turkish abstract with a maximum of 50 words.

The parts constituting the main theme of an article and other significant parts must be underlined.

After the arbitrator fee is reduced from royalty, which is to be calculated on the basis previously determined by the Turkish Co-operative Association for such articles, the remainder shall be paid to author.

Five apiece journals are to be delivered to authors, whose articles are published on the Journal.

The Journal conforms to the Professional Press Principles.
